Transaction 61e91d7f0bf9cc9a2e5f22a0d9139afec3ee6d0f55f56963d4d46e96febb7865

27 Input
2 Outputs
  • 61e91d7f0bf9cc9a2e5f22a0d9139afec3ee6d0f55f56963d4d46e96febb7865:0
  • value  29612000
    address  1LFc7mTqTwE1gY9REpgWiorid56M41EBt8
  • 61e91d7f0bf9cc9a2e5f22a0d9139afec3ee6d0f55f56963d4d46e96febb7865:1
  • value  4798104
    address  1CsLDgPj1AaKEkKMbeCnbxbJAkDffWT4XB